Searched refs:JSRetainPtr (Results 1 - 12 of 12) sorted by relevance

/macosx-10.9.5/JavaScriptCore-7537.78.1/ForwardingHeaders/JavaScriptCore/
H A DJSRetainPtr.h1 #include <JavaScriptCore/API/JSRetainPtr.h>
/macosx-10.9.5/JavaScriptCore-7537.78.1/API/
H A DJSRetainPtr.h43 template<typename T> class JSRetainPtr { class
45 JSRetainPtr() : m_ptr(0) { } function in class:JSRetainPtr
46 JSRetainPtr(T ptr) : m_ptr(ptr) { if (ptr) JSRetain(ptr); } function in class:JSRetainPtr
47 JSRetainPtr(AdoptTag, T ptr) : m_ptr(ptr) { } function in class:JSRetainPtr
48 JSRetainPtr(const JSRetainPtr&);
49 template<typename U> JSRetainPtr(const JSRetainPtr<U>&);
50 ~JSRetainPtr();
62 typedef T JSRetainPtr
78 template<typename T> inline JSRetainPtr<T>::JSRetainPtr(const JSRetainPtr& o) function in class:JSRetainPtr
85 template<typename T> template<typename U> inline JSRetainPtr<T>::JSRetainPtr(const JSRetainPtr<U>& o) function in class:JSRetainPtr
[all...]
H A DJSStringRefQt.cpp42 JSRetainPtr<JSStringRef> JSStringCreateWithQString(const QString& qString)
47 return JSRetainPtr<JSStringRef>(Adopt, jsString.release().leakRef());
49 return JSRetainPtr<JSStringRef>(Adopt, OpaqueJSString::create().leakRef());
H A DJSStringRefQt.h31 #include "JSRetainPtr.h"
43 JS_EXPORT JSRetainPtr<JSStringRef> JSStringCreateWithQString(const QString&);
H A DJSObjectRef.cpp49 #include "JSRetainPtr.h"
600 Vector<JSRetainPtr<JSStringRef> > array;
622 propertyNames->array.uncheckedAppend(JSRetainPtr<JSStringRef>(Adopt, OpaqueJSString::create(array[i].string()).leakRef()));
/macosx-10.9.5/JavaScriptCore-7537.78.1/JavaScriptCore.vcxproj/
H A Dcopy-files.cmd22 JSRetainPtr.h
23 JSRetainPtr.h
/macosx-10.9.5/WebKit2-7537.78.2/WebProcess/qt/
H A DQtBuiltinBundlePage.cpp38 #include <JavaScriptCore/JSRetainPtr.h>
117 JSRetainPtr<JSStringRef> jsContents = JSValueToStringCopy(context, arguments[0], 0);
143 JSRetainPtr<JSStringRef> jsData = WKStringCopyJSString(data);
/macosx-10.9.5/WebKit-7537.78.2/blackberry/WebKitSupport/
H A DPagePopup.cpp28 #include "JSRetainPtr.h"
92 JSRetainPtr<JSStringRef> string(Adopt, JSValueToStringCopy(context, arguments[0], 0));
/macosx-10.9.5/WebCore-7537.78.1/bridge/qt/
H A Dqt_pixmapruntime.cpp31 #include "JSRetainPtr.h"
166 JSRetainPtr<JSStringRef> str(Adopt, JSStringCreateWithUTF8CString(encoded.constData()));
177 JSRetainPtr<JSStringRef> str(Adopt, JSStringCreateWithUTF8CString(stringValue.toUtf8().constData()));
H A Dqt_runtime.cpp39 #include "JSRetainPtr.h"
277 JSRetainPtr<JSStringRef> string(Adopt, JSValueToStringCopy(context, value, 0));
448 JSRetainPtr<JSStringRef> str(Adopt, JSValueToStringCopy(context, value, exception));
466 JSRetainPtr<JSStringRef> str(Adopt, JSValueToStringCopy(context, value, exception));
1284 JSRetainPtr<JSStringRef> actualNameStr(Adopt, JSStringCreateWithUTF8CString(m_identifier.constData()));
1380 JSRetainPtr<JSStringRef> functionName(Adopt, JSValueToStringCopy(context, arguments[1], &conversionException));
1569 JSRetainPtr<JSStringRef> lengthProperty(Adopt, JSStringCreateWithUTF8CString("length"));
/macosx-10.9.5/WebKit2-7537.78.2/UIProcess/API/gtk/tests/
H A DWebViewTest.cpp24 #include <JavaScriptCore/JSRetainPtr.h>
368 JSRetainPtr<JSStringRef> stringValue(Adopt, JSValueToStringCopy(context, value, 0));
/macosx-10.9.5/WebKit2-7537.78.2/UIProcess/API/qt/
H A Dqquickwebview.cpp64 #include <JavaScriptCore/JSRetainPtr.h>
141 JSRetainPtr<JSStringRef> string = JSValueToStringCopy(context, value, &exception);
156 JSRetainPtr<JSStringRef> name = JSPropertyNameArrayGetNameAtIndex(names, i);

Completed in 149 milliseconds